Managed to land a new pb today. I know there's bigger and I'm gonna find them eventually. She ate the Wade Hoggs which was a super exciting bite. I'm not a big top water or wake guy at all but dam that was an unexpected bite! I've been targeting stripes with swimbaits the last few years and haven't really took the time to figure out how to approach the green ones. The last couple months the striper bite really died in my area and I had to find a way to feel that tug. So I stepped outside my normal comfort zone and started to break down some new water while searching for the green ones. I noticed the gill were spawning and it was a no brainer that I needed to be throwing a gill bait. I've tried a handful of baits but ended up having the most confidence in the Wade Hoggs. The size,action, and noise it throws off seemed like it would make for a killer snack. I'm glad I stuck with my gut feeling and decided to stick with it. Here she is. A 6lb 3oz Nevada fish. I know it' no DD but it' a huge step in the right direction for me and a respectable fish for my area. #ofisholyreel

I suggest sending it out to a "Wrapping Professional". This will probably be the smartest, quickest, and best fix IMO. The guys that wrap baits have to strip all the old paint off and will be able to see all the damage and cracks. They'll probably lay an epoxy coat and then lay the wrap and another coat of epoxy. That's what I would do if I were in your shoes. Its better then having a paper weight and waiting on Roman to may or may not come through. I highly recommend Alex @ Realistic ofcourse
